RCW 42.08.120

Should such officer, after due notice, fail to appear at the time appointed, the matter may be heard and determined in his or her absence; if after examination the board of county commissioners shall be of opinion that the bond of such officer has become insufficient from any cause whatever, they shall require an additional bond with such security as may be deemed necessary, which said additional bond shall be executed and filed within such time as the board of county commissioners may order; and if any such officer shall fail to execute and file such additional bond within the time prescribed by such order, his or her office shall become vacant.
[ 2012 c 117 s 101 ; 1890 p 36 s 7 ; RRS s 9936.]
Notes:
Failure to give or renew official bond a cause for vacation of office: RCW 42.12.010 .
